centos上sqlserver如何升级

发布时间 - 2025-06-06 00:00:00    点击率:

在centos上升级sql server的操作流程如下:

升级前准备

  1. 数据备份:在执行任何升级操作之前,务必对所有数据库进行全面备份,以避免因升级失败而导致的数据丢失风险。
  2. 兼容性核查:确认现有SQL Server版本与目标版本间的兼容性,并确保相关应用程序支持新版本提供的功能。

新版本SQL Server的安装

  1. 配置安装源

    • 若是SQL Server 2019,可运行以下命令添加yum源:``` curl -o /etc/yum.repos.d/mssql-server-2019.repo https://www./link/0378944aa0da95a0e9bf1edcf0f447ee curl -o /etc/yum.repos.d/msprod.repo https://www./link/fd82bcc747197ebb3ecdf6d87e0d86b3
    • 对于SQL Server 2025,请参照对应版本的yum源说明。
  2. 开始安装

     sudo yum install mssql-server
  3. 数据库初始化

     /opt/mssql/bin/mssql-conf setup
  4. 数据库升级

    • 完成安装后,使用以下命令进行数据库升级:``` ALTER DATABASE [YourDatabaseName] SET COMPATIBILITY_LEVEL 150; -- 150代表SQL Server 2025
  5. 检查升级效果

    • 利用DBCC CHECKDB命令检测数据库的完整性:``` DBCC CHECKDB ([YourDatabaseName])
    • 检查所有关联的应用程序,确保其功能正常运作。

遇到问题时的应对策略

  • 兼容性障碍:如发现存储过程、视图或函数在新版本下运行异常,可通过调整数据库的兼容级别予以解决。
  • 安装难题:查阅安装日志文件定位具体问题所在,并采取相应措施修复。

关键注意事项

  • 升级期间需保证系统处于最新状态,并且安装必需的依赖组件。
  • 升级前务必备份数据,以免影响系统启动和业务开展。

按照上述步骤,您便能在CentOS上顺利完成SQL Server的更新或升级任务,保障数据和系统的可靠性。


# centos  # sqlserver  # 数据丢失  # sql  # cURL  # database  # 数据库  # https  # microsoft  # mssql  # 新版本  # 应用程序  # 可通过  # 便能  # 进行全面  # 存储过程  # 数据备份  # 系统启动  # 操作流程 


相关栏目: 【 网站优化151355 】 【 网络推广146373 】 【 网络技术251813 】 【 AI营销90571


相关推荐: Laravel Pest测试框架怎么用_从PHPUnit转向Pest的Laravel测试教程  JavaScript 输出显示内容(document.write、alert、innerHTML、console.log)  如何在阿里云购买域名并搭建网站?  手机怎么制作网站教程步骤,手机怎么做自己的网页链接?  Python文件异常处理策略_健壮性说明【指导】  如何批量查询域名的建站时间记录?  如何在IIS中新建站点并配置端口与IP地址?  Laravel怎么发送邮件_Laravel Mail类SMTP配置教程  php做exe能调用系统命令吗_执行cmd指令实现方式【详解】  浅谈javascript alert和confirm的美化  网易LOFTER官网链接 老福特网页版登录地址  在Oracle关闭情况下如何修改spfile的参数  如何使用 jQuery 正确渲染 Instagram 风格的标签列表  android nfc常用标签读取总结  Laravel如何使用Telescope进行调试?(安装和使用教程)  如何自定义safari浏览器工具栏?个性化设置safari浏览器界面教程【技巧】  Laravel软删除怎么实现_Laravel Eloquent SoftDeletes功能使用教程  手机网站制作与建设方案,手机网站如何建设?  Linux系统命令中screen命令详解  Laravel用户认证怎么做_Laravel Breeze脚手架快速实现登录注册功能  打造顶配客厅影院,这份100寸电视推荐名单请查收  php增删改查怎么学_零基础入门php数据库操作必知基础【教程】  Laravel Livewire是什么_使用Laravel Livewire构建动态前端界面  如何快速生成高效建站系统源代码?  英语简历制作免费网站推荐,如何将简历翻译成英文?  如何在万网ECS上快速搭建专属网站?  HTML透明颜色代码在Angular里怎么设置_Angular透明颜色使用指南【详解】  Laravel如何处理和验证JSON类型的数据库字段  Laravel怎么实现验证码功能_Laravel集成验证码库防止机器人注册  如何自己制作一个网站链接,如何制作一个企业网站,建设网站的基本步骤有哪些?  Laravel如何安装使用Debugbar工具栏_Laravel性能调试与SQL监控插件【步骤】  详解免费开源的.NET多类型文件解压缩组件SharpZipLib(.NET组件介绍之七)  什么是JavaScript解构赋值_解构赋值有哪些实用技巧  在centOS 7安装mysql 5.7的详细教程  如何快速搭建高效WAP手机网站?  微信小程序 require机制详解及实例代码  laravel服务容器和依赖注入怎么理解_laravel服务容器与依赖注入解析  js实现点击每个li节点,都弹出其文本值及修改  头像制作网站在线观看,除了站酷,还有哪些比较好的设计网站?  如何实现javascript表单验证_正则表达式有哪些实用技巧  如何在香港免费服务器上快速搭建网站?  Laravel怎么使用Session存储数据_Laravel会话管理与自定义驱动配置【详解】  Laravel如何实现多级无限分类_Laravel递归模型关联与树状数据输出【方法】  浅述节点的创建及常见功能的实现  Laravel怎么判断请求类型_Laravel Request isMethod用法  移动端脚本框架Hammer.js  javascript日期怎么处理_如何格式化输出  如何快速搭建自助建站会员专属系统?  Laravel如何为API生成Swagger或OpenAPI文档  如何在IIS7中新建站点?详细步骤解析